Alp Trails offers a range of full day or half day hikes in Haute Savoie in the French Alps. Annecy, Chamonix and La Clusaz/Grand Bornand are the three base locations for these day tours. Between them they offer hundreds of kilometres of world-class trails to explore.

  • In Chamonix a great option is to hike along the Grand Balcon du Nord on a trail that traverses beneath the famous peaks named the Chamonix Aiguilles (needles) and gets you up close to some of the most spectacular glaciers in the Alps.

  • From Annecy we may choose to hike the Mt Veyrier/Mt Baron skyline ridge, affording unparalleled views of the lake, 800m below. For the more intrepid, there is the rugged La Tourette, at 2351m, the principle peak overlooking the lake.

  • From La Clusaz or the Grand Bornand it is easy to drive up to one of the high passes, Col des Aravis or Col de la Colombière and hike panoramic trails from there. These cols always feature a cafe/restaurant offering welcome refreshments at the end of the hike!
